Gennaro Gattuso sacked by Valencia after seven months
Valencia have sacked manager Gennaro Gattuso after just seven months in charge of the La Liga club.

The former AC Milan and Napoli manager ends his short reign with Valencia languishing in 14th in the table, only one point above the relegation zone.
The 45-year-old's final match was a 1-0 away defeat to Real Valladolid on Sunday. Voro takes control of first-team duties, his eighth caretaker spell in charge at Valencia.
A statement from the club read: "Valencia CF announce that this Monday, January 30th, the club and the first-team coach, Gennaro Gattuso, have decided by mutual agreement to end the contractual relationship between the two parties.
"The club wish to thank Gattuso for his commitment and work during his time in charge and wish him the best of luck for the future.
"The team will return to training this Tuesday, January 31st, under 'Voro' Gonzalez."
